How do you give your creator praise? Mike Palmer- 1999

I was thinking that I would begin by praising Him for what He’s done for me (gave His only son to die in my place, freed me from my sin, given me a reason to live, adopted me, forgiven me, washed me clean, purchased me). When I’m done doing that I could praise Him what he has given me (My family, my home, my car, my wife, my kids, my job, my heritage, my health, my sanity, my joy, my strength, my ability, my wisdom, my freedom, my happiness, my church, my boss, my friends, my parents, my toys, my knowledge). He gave me these things which I realize are not really mine but he has put them in my care.

What have I done to deserve any of this? What kind of praise can I give? If I throw myself in front of Him and weep and cry worthy is that enough? What is a sacrifice of praise? How come I don’t know what it is? If I am really one of His children then why don’t I know how to give Him high praise? Can I become an expert on praise?

My flesh cannot praise the Lord. It does not have the capacity. It does not know how to praise him. It is dust. There is nothing my flesh has to offer God. All I have that is of any value to him is my soul because it already belongs to Him. I do not have the ability or the capacity to give him the soul he gave me. I need Him for everything!

Lord let me praise with all my soul and all my strength and take the dust of my flesh and use it to bring glory to you.

I look around me and see all the people suffering with pain, sorrow and or handicaps. My heart goes out to them, but I really have nothing to offer. I cannot provide for them, I cannot free them from their hurt; I cannot heal them. Many of these people have needs that require great dependency on others. I seem to crave independence; I work for it. Could it be that the real message is that, we need those people as much as they need us?

I have always equated praise with the use of music and song. Could it be that the music is just the medium that makes it easier to praise You? Does music please You or do You just use the music to vibrate our dust and allow us to feel the expression.

Is praise simply a response to seeing Your hand in everything that happens to us? Like saying “WOW” when we notice that you really are in control and have answered our prayers.

I know that You created us to worship You and I’d really like to know how I can do it, when I feel like I do right now. My prayer is that I could just do as Micah 6:8 says, ‘Do justly, love mercy and walk humbly with thy God.’
